DOWN SYNDROME - A CHALLENGE FOR THE PARENTS, SUPPORT FOR MATURITY OF THE SOCIETY- A TRIBUNE

Journal Title: Journal of Special Education and Rehabilitation - Year 2012, Vol 13, Issue 1

Abstract

On the 15.10.2011, in the large amphitheatre at the Faculty of Philosophy in Skopje, was held a tribune with the title "Down Syndrome, a challenge for the parents, support for maturity of the society". The tribune was organized by the Macedonian Scientific Society for Autism and “Trisomy 21” Association from Zagreb, Croatia. The goal of the tribune was to encourage opinions and to support general sensibility in the community, as well as to present the needs of the people with Down Syndrome as an equal members of the society. This is proposed together with greater benefits from the state institutions in order to improve the quality of the lifestyle of these category of people, as well as the members of their families. This event was covered by the media and had more than 300 visitors. Parents, students, experts and persons with Down Syndrome could be seen among the audience in the auditorium.
